Full Description

Show more
The Hillsborough County Board of County Commissioners (County) is seeking competitive sealed bids from experienced and qualified Contractors to provide regulatory road and street signs material and parts. The resulting contract will be for a three (3)-year period. The project's estimate is $3,452,690.25.

Solicitation- Interior Wayfinding Directional SignageThis procurement is a total Service-Disabled Veteran-Owned Small Business (SDVOSB) set-aside under NAICS code 339950 for the installation, removal, and replacement of interior directional signage at the Corporal Michael J. Crescenz Veterans Affairs Medical Center in Philadelphia, Pennsylvania. The scope includes the design, manufacturing, and installation of approximately 650 new signage elements—including directory signs, directional signs of varying sizes, restroom signs, wall graphics, floor maps, elevator notices, and life safety signage—while removing outdated hardware and signs. All signage must conform to VA design standards, ADA accessibility guidelines, and ASTM testing requirements for water absorption, temperature, freeze-thaw, salt spray, and flame spread, and must be interchangeable with the existing institutional sign system. The contract requires full compliance with Federal Acquisition Regulation (FAR) clauses including 52.212-1, 52.212-4, and numerous addendums covering whistleblower rights, subcontracting restrictions, procurement integrity, and contractor employee protections. Participation is strictly limited to certified SDVOSBs listed in the SBA certification database, and offerors must submit formal certifications of ownership, small business status, limitations on subcontracting, Buy American or Trade Agreements compliance, and other statutory representations. Proposals must include five similar projects completed within the last eight years, four of which must be for VA or military hospitals, and require samples of signage for evaluation. The solicitation mandates the submission of complete SF 1449 forms with all required blocks, OEM authorization letters if applicable, and descriptive literature, with quotes submitted via email to the Contract Specialist by the deadline of July 28, 2026 at 4:00 PM EDT. Award will be made on a Lowest Price Technically Acceptable basis, and failure to meet any pass/fail gate—including SDVOSB certification, past performance, product specifications, or sample submission—will render a proposal ineligible. The contract includes FOB Destination delivery terms to the facility at 3900 Woodland Avenue, Philadelphia, PA 19104, with quarterly invoicing in arrears via electronic funds transfer and detailed payment requirements including TIN, billing address, and shipment documentation. The contractor must designate an on-site project manager for oversight and adhere to all applicable federal, state, and local laws, including OSHA, Contract Work Hours and Safety Standards, and procurement integrity statutes.

Install 16 FPCON Signs on USAG-HumphreysThe U.S. Army Installation Management Command is seeking market research information for the design, installation, and integration of a Force Protection Condition (FPCON) LED Messaging System at USAG Humphreys in the Republic of Korea. The requirement calls for sixteen wireless FPCON LED display boards with full color RGB capabilities, each featuring a minimum brightness of 7,000 to 10,000 nits for outdoor daytime visibility, automatic ambient light sensing for adaptive dimming, 120V/240V AC power with internal surge protection, and wireless connectivity to receive messages from a central sending unit. The system also includes a single laptop or PC-based sending unit equipped with an Intel Core i5/i7 or AMD equivalent processor, at least sixteen gigabytes of DDR4/DDR5 memory, a minimum 256 GB TCG Opal 2.0 compliant self-encrypting SSD, and a small form factor design, along with four wireless repeaters to ensure reliable signal coverage across the entire installation. The contractor must provide all personnel, equipment, materials, and services necessary to install, program, test, and coordinate the system in full compliance with the Performance Work Statement, including ongoing coordination with government personnel. This notice is issued under FAR Part 10 for market research purposes only and does not constitute a solicitation or an obligation by the government to award a contract. Vendors interested in being considered for any future procurement must submit a capability statement via email to mamadou.o.diallo.mil@army.mil no later than 1500 KST on July 27, 2026. Submissions must demonstrate relevant experience, technical ability to meet the specified requirements, and business size status. All costs associated with preparing and submitting a response are borne solely by the vendor, and the government will not reimburse any expenses incurred. Responses will be used exclusively to compile a list of qualified prospective vendors for potential future acquisition actions under the NAICS code 339950 associated with the solicitation number W91QVN26MXXXX.

181 BillboardThe U.S. Air Force is soliciting a single firm-fixed-price contract for the procurement, delivery, and installation of one freestanding billboard framework at 970 Petercheff Street, Terre Haute, Indiana, with a required completion date within 90 days of award. The billboard must support twelve 4x8-foot, quarter-inch aluminum panels and include a UFC-compliant concrete pad with a one-foot perimeter offset, flat steel-trowel finish, minimum 4,000 PSI compressive strength, and air-entrained mix designed for freeze-thaw resistance. The structure must meet strict dimensional and engineering criteria including a ground clearance no higher than 1.5 feet above finished grade, reinforced with ASTM A615 Grade 60 rebar, and engineered to withstand regional wind loads per ASCE 7 and UFC 3-301-01 standards. All materials and installations must conform to exact structural specifications outlined in the Statement of Work, and any proposed alternative products must provide full technical documentation to be considered equivalent. The solicitation is a total small business set-aside under NAICS code 339950, with offers due by 1:00 PM Eastern Standard Time on July 31, 2026, submitted via email to the designated point of contact. All responders must be registered in SAM.gov and submit complete technical data, including UEI, CAGE code, delivery timeline, shipping costs to the specified location, and pricing details. Awards will be determined based on a best-value evaluation considering price, technical acceptability, and delivery performance, with no interchange expected unless the Government initiates further communication. Late submissions will be rejected unless the Contracting Officer determines they do not unduly delay the acquisition.
